Output 74edb04c027b085e77e46c573218265d03c831745a29f1de4c7f7dfd25daafb1:0

value
661726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091bfacaacf9060dd47f32ea0754bee59ebb1db8 OP_EQUAL
address
32XBXL8stu8H8297PLMN8moHJL4KtjEiDx
transaction
74edb04c027b085e77e46c573218265d03c831745a29f1de4c7f7dfd25daafb1
spent
true